Abstract
Ethylene is polymerized by means of a catalyst which comprises a borohydride (preferably of an alkali metal e.g. N, Na or Li), AlX3 (X = halogen, preferably Cl) and a Group IVa metal halide preferably TiCl4. Polymerization is preferably carried out in an inert solvent for ethylene such as a hydrocarbon which may be aromatic (e.g. benzene, toluene, xylene), aliphatic (e.g. dodecane) or cycloaliphatic (e.g. cyclohexane, decahydronaphthalene); it is preferable, when using a solvent, to pass a stream of ethylene continuously and to agitate the reaction mixture vigorously, and unreacted ethylene may be recovered and returned to the reaction. The polytthylenes produced have m.p.s. in the range 125-170 DEG C., the m.p. being defined as the p temperature at which a sample begins to become clear and lose its crystallinity. The reaction is quenched with methanol and the polymers purified by means of dilute aqueous KOH, dilute alcoholic KOH, water and methanol.ALSO:A catalyst for ethylene polymerization comprises a (preferably alkali) metal borohydride (e.g. of Na, K or Li), an Al halide (preferably chloride) and a halide of Ti, Zr, Hf or Th (preferably TiCl4). Preferably the catalyst is formed in an inert liquid (particularly a hydrocarbon especially when cyclic e.g. xylene) which is a solvent for ethylene, in the absence of free oxygen and in a nitrogen atmosphere; particularly a mixture of borohydride and Al halide is heated in the solvent at 60-110 DEG C. for at least 30 minutes before adding the second metal halide. The preferred molar ratio AlCl3: TiCl4:NaBH4 is 0.1-1:0.1-1:1. Optionally, the catalyst may be deposited on a carrier such as cryolite, clays, silica-alumina cracking catalysts and charcoal and the deposition may be carried out in e.g. xylene or decahydronaphthalene.
